Locks that aren't working
Although a lock issue is never ideal It is important not to be in a panic or delay getting it fixed. It might seem like an issue that isn't too significant, but a faulty lock can have serious consequences for the security of your home. Yet most homeowners don't put a priority on fixing door lock issues until they experience an attack or another type of damage that they could have avoided had they addressed the issue earlier.
It's not uncommon for a key to stop turning within the lock cylinder. It could be caused by a foreign object within the lock, a misaligned strike plate or an old key. Try using compressed air to get rid of any dirt or dust from the lock. You can also try graphite or another dry lubricant in order to make the lock turn smoothly. We recommend against using oil-based lubricants, because they draw dirt over time.
A misaligned or displaced strikeplate is another common cause. This can be corrected by loosening screws and adjusting plate position to align with the hole of the latch. If this isn't working, you could try tightening the hinges, and then adjusting the latch to ensure it is more secure against the frame.
A misaligned door or frame can also result in a misaligned locking mechanism. This could be due to environmental factors, such as changes in temperature and exposure to moisture. The frame can shift or become uneven with time. This could cause the strike plate to become out of alignment with the locking point.

Broken Locks
Locks can stop working because of wear and tear. This is particularly true for low-quality locks that are more prone to damage due to environmental elements and heavy use. If you notice that your lock breaking down, it's important to contact an expert locksmith for repairs as soon as possible. This will ensure that the process of repair is completed quickly.
In addition to wear and tear, a broken lock can also be caused by environmental factors such as extreme weather conditions or poor construction. To prevent this from happening, it's important to choose a high-quality lock that is designed to last and resist the elements. You can also extend the life of your locks by lubricating and cleaning them frequently.
A damaged handle mechanism is another frequent problem that can affect conservatory door hinge replacement doors. The problem can be easily repaired by tightening screws on the handle of the door using the help of a screwdriver. If you're unable to fix it yourself, you could apply a silicone oil or lubricating spray in order to avoid the mechanism becoming stuck.
In some cases, the issue may be an accumulation of dirt or grime that's making it difficult to open the lock. In these instances it's recommended to make use of a cotton swab or similar tool to remove the dirt and grime out of the lock. If this does not solve the issue, you can apply a graphite or silicone spray to lubricate the lock.

Damaged Locks
Locks are susceptible to damage in many ways over time. This can be due to wear and tear, misalignment or even environmental elements. A broken lock can be difficult to latch or open and also provide easy access to burglars. This type of damage can be repaired by a professional locksmith.
One of the most common problems with the conservatory door is that the handle will become loose. It isn't easy to latch a door, and the handle may spin when you try to lock it. This could lead to the door mechanism becoming damaged, and in certain cases it can even break completely.

Locks can be affected by many issues like keys breaking or a lack of lubrication. Dirt and debris can accumulate in the lock's mechanisms which makes it difficult to insert or turn a key smoothly. Cleaning and lubricating regularly your lock can prevent this. Extreme weather conditions can also cause damage to locks, so making sure they are secure from moisture and extreme heat or cold can help to extend their lifespan.
Another issue with upvc conservatory repairs near me locks is that they can freeze in extremely cold temperatures. This makes it difficult to open the door, but it is relatively simple to fix this issue by heating the key in hot water or placing it on a radiator prior to inserting it into the lock.
